X - 11 - This is the best roller coaster I have ever been on. Short, but very, very sweet. To start out, it is the complete opposite of every other Arrow I have been on. I usually associate an Arrow looper with roughness and a wicked beating. Viper, for example (more on this later). But Arrow has changed completely. On other Arrow coasters, your head is between the restraints, so it slams into their non-existant padding at every turn. Your head is above the restraints on X, eliminating the problem. And the head padding is excellent. It is the best padding I've ever encountered on a roller coaster. Very soft and thick, it prevents any pain at all. Arrow's restraints here are just awesome. Woo. As for the ride, it's fast, quick, and very disorienting. The absolute best part is definately the first drop. Before I rode X on Saturday, I wasn't exactly sure what was meant by "Skydiving Drop". Turns out it's laying on your stomach. It is, by far, the most thrilling, exciting, and just plain FUN drop I've ever experienced. I don't remember much about the rest of the coaster, other than that the seat movement was used perfectly. The ride was not rough at all. Very nice.

The line for X moved very slowly, even when two trains were used. A full half of each train is reserved for, and only accessable by, FastLane users. While this is nice for FastLane users (me), and works fine now, when a lot of people are using it, eventually popularity will die off, and trains will leave with a lot of empty seats. Perhaps SFMM will add a way for 'normal' riders to get to the FastLane half of the train. In the afternoon, the line for X stretched through the entire queue line, across the bridge to X, and down the stairs to the main path, about a 4 hour wait. FastLane recommended very much here.
